Tuesday, Sept. 24th is National Punctuation Day. A day to be aware of every period, comma, semi-colon and question mark. Correct punctuation is so important – it can add, subtract, or change the entire meaning of a passage. Just look at this example:

Writing That Sounds Right

Write with rhythm, use alliteration in word phrases, listen to your words.  Sometimes it takes reading out loud to “hear” your written words and determine if the dialog sounds too formal, too stilted or is natural sounding to the ear.
